Cover Story: This wireless bi-directional brain–computer interface integrates Bluetooth and Wi-Fi modes, enabling flexible neural recording and stimulation. The Bluetooth mode is optimized for low-frequency signals, while the Wi-Fi supports high-frequency recordings with exceptional fidelity. With customizable biphasic current pulses for stimulation and a compact, lightweight design, this system offers unparalleled versatility for neuroscience research and neural modulation applications.
